One more question
 
I currently have Pilot Sports on my car, 17". I need to replace them soon and I've read good reviews on tirerack.com about the BF Goodrich T/A KDW 2's, and they're quite a bit less than the Pilot Sports. Anyone have any experience with these on their Boxster? The car is driven summer only, I drive it hard but don't autocross or anything.
